A Midsommar Night with Jim and Teal.

If it’s mid-July, that can only mean one thing: it’s time for a fun round of ‘Skin the Fool!” Grab your May pole, kettle of mushroom tea, and get set for an hour of midnight sun hilarity as Jim and Teal tackle Ari Aster’s mind-bending psychological, horror, thrill-ride, Midsommar. Hear Jim lose his cool when Teal goads him about the latest entry from the gang at Marvel, Spider Man: Far From Home. Take sides in the Teal-sponsored, Kill List challenge. Love Midsommar? Can’t get enough of this messy-relationship pagan folk cult mostly daylight horror revenge flick? Get the 411 on many of Hollywood’s other cult-movie offerings in this week’s episode.

A warning to the devoted: Jim and Teal can not tell the tale of Midsommar without a heaping amount of spoilers, so if you haven’t seen the film, you may want to skip this episode after the first ten minutes, because once they get into it, they really get into it.

And don’t worry about that bear in a cage; we promise, it is just a bear in a cage.
